In one study of 116 people with HSV, those who applied lemon balm cream to their lip sores experienced significant improvement in redness and swelling after only 2 days

The next symptoms experienced by individuals infected with the virus are often associated with the "opportunistic infections" that target individuals with AIDS such as pneumonia, fungal infections, and HIV-specific cancers such as Kaposi sarcoma. If early HIV infection is suspected, your provider can test directly for the virus, using a test called "PCR" or a "4th generation" HIV test that looks for the antibody and the virus at the same time), as well as doing the standard antibody test to determine whether HIV is present in the blood.Once the primary or acute infection is over, most people do not experience any visible symptoms for another 8-10 years
